GM Gen 4 ECMs must be reprogrammed using GM SPS and appropriate programming tools, not HP Tuners. The ECM has 8 segments but there are two for electronic throttle that HP Tuners does not read or write. Even if you found what you're looking for and flashed it it would leave you with an unworkable combo of the 6 new segments and two old ones left behind.
